What is Quinoa Oil?

Quinoa oil is a vegetable oil that is derived from the quinoa plant. Quinoa oil is high in antioxidants and has a nutty flavor. It is also high in omega-3 fatty acids, which are beneficial for heart health. Quinoa oil is a good source of vitamin E and magnesium.

Benefits of Quinoa Oil for Skin

Quinoa oil is high in antioxidants and has many benefits for the skin. Quinoa oil is an excellent choice for people with oily skin because it helps control sebum secretion.

It also helps reduce the appearance of pores and can even be used to treat acne. Quinoa oil is effective at reducing the signs of aging, such as wrinkles and age spots.

Provides antioxidant protection for the skin

Quinoa oil is rich in antioxidants, which makes it a beneficial choice for skincare. Quinoa oil can help to protect the skin from damage caused by free radicals. It also helps to keep the skin hydrated and look younger. Quinoa oil can be used as a moisturizer, or it can be added to other skincare products.

Firms and brightens the skin

People have been using quinoa oil for centuries, but it has only recently become popular in the United States. The oil is extracted from the quinoa seed and is high in antioxidants, vitamin E, and fatty acids.

These nutrients make quinoa oil a powerful anti-aging agent. It firms and brightens the skin, and it can also be used to treat acne and other skin problems.

Strengthens the skin barrier

Quinoa oil is a rich source of antioxidants, which help to protect the skin from free radical damage. Additionally, quinoa oil helps to strengthen the skin barrier, which can help to keep the skin hydrated and protected from external factors. Quinoa oil is also non-irritating, making it a good choice for people with sensitive skin.

Deeply moisturizes the skin

Quinoa oil has a high concentration of antioxidants and beneficial fatty acids, which deeply moisturize the skin. The oil is non-greasy and easily absorbed, making it an ideal choice for people with dry skin. In addition, quinoa oil helps to protect the skin from sun damage and premature aging.

How to use quinoa oil

Quinoa oil is a great natural moisturizer for the skin. It is rich in antioxidants, vitamin E, and fatty acids, which help to nourish and protect the skin. Quinoa oil can be used as a standalone moisturizer or added to your favorite skincare products.

To use quinoa oil as a standalone moisturizer, apply a few drops to your hands and massage into your skin. For best results, use it morning and night. You can add quinoa oil to your favorite skincare products, such as face wash, serum, or lotion.
